Summary
An Act To Amend Section 31-11-3, Mississippi Code Of 1972, To Provide That When Utilizing The Construction Manager At-risk Method Of Project Delivery, The Department Of Finance And Administration May Require The Manager To Procure Any And All Resulting Construction Contracts Necessary To Complete The Project; To Provide That All Such Contracts Shall Be Between The Manager And The Contractors And Shall Be Exempt From The Provisions Of The Bid Law; To Amend Section 31-7-13, Mississippi Code Of 1972, In Conformity Thereto; And For Related Purposes.
